'Janey-come-lately': Wasserman Schultz finally calls on sleazy San Diego mayor to resign

At least seven women have now come forward to accuse San Diego Mayor Bob Filner of unwanted sexual advances, but Democratic women politicians have been conspicuously silent on the matter of the handsy harasser.
